Full Job Description

The Central Primary Care team are looking for an experienced, organised and enthusiastic Administration/Clerical Support Officer/Departmental Receptionist to work in our Health Board managed GP Practice Healthy Prestatyn Iach, Prestatyn

Previous experience of working within a GP Practice would be beneficial and knowledge of the EMIS clinical system is desirable, however training can be given. The demands of a GP practice can change on a daily basis and therefore this role will be challenging., The post holder will be booking appointments and dealing with patient queries, over the phone and face to face, ordering and printing repeat prescriptions, therefore excellent communication skills and a confident telephone manner is required.

Proficient IT skills (including experience of Microsoft office) is also required as the post holder will also be undertaking a variety of administrative duties, scanning, summarising, workflow and private patient income work, all to assist in the smooth day to day running of the practices.

The ideal candidate will have experience of working in a healthcare setting or a customer service environment but full training can be given to the right candidate.
